redies应用场景讲述.docx

Redis应用场景目录(?)[-]1 ?MySqlMemcached架构的问题2 ?Redis常用数据类型3 ?各种数据类型应用和实现方式String Hash List Set Sorted Set PubSub Transactions 4 ?Redis实际应用场景显示最新的项目列表删除与过滤排行榜相关按照用户投票和时间排序处理过期项目计数特定时间内的特定项目实时分析正在发生的情况用于数据统计与防止垃圾邮件等PubSub队列缓存5 ?国内外三个不同领域巨头分享的Redis实战经验及使用场景一新浪微博史上最大的Redis集群Redis使用场景Redis使用的重要点Plans in future二PinterestReids维护上百亿的相关性三ViacomRedis在系统中的用例盘点Memcached采用客户端-服务器的架构,客户端和服务器端的通讯使用自定义的协议标准,只要满足协议格式要求,客户端Library可以用任何语言实现。Memcached服务器使用基于Slab的内存管理方式,有利于减少内存碎片和频繁分配销毁内存所带来的开销。各个Slab按需动态分配一个page的内存(和4Kpage的概念不同,这里默认page为1M),page内部按照不同slab class的尺寸再划分为内存chunk供服务器存储KV键值对使用(slab机制相当于内存池机制, 实现从操作系统分配一大块内存

文档评论(0)

1亿VIP精品文档

相关文档